Maximizing Internship Opportunities
Summary
First with this workshop we learned the importance of obtaining an internship while we are students in school and that is to gain more work experience, have better networking, and to have higher salaries after graduation.
After learning the importance of internships, Natalie then talked about how to get an internship and she highly recommended that we look outside our comfort zone and think outside the box when looking for an internship. Also, it is important to look for industries that are currently hiring even if we do not have an interest in that field because a lot of companies are not hiring right now due to the bad economy. She also said that we need to read the fine print of the internship description before we actually commit because it could be an internship that would be only peon duties. Also, it is a good idea to research the company before applying for them that way you know about the company before your interview and talk about how you would benefit the company.
The four recommendations that Natalie had for us for internships was to be professional in the workplace and to remember its not all about you, and don't create more work for somebody else. The second was to be proactive and to seek opportunities by going above and beyond what is just expected. She also suggested it would be a good idea to job shadow those you will be working with. Thirdly work well and work hard by always having a good attitude even during the projects and assignments you don't want to do, be helpful at all times , and stay busy during work hours and that you always need to be working and find work to do. The last recommendation is to build relationships and build bridges with everyone that you work with in the office, and always say thank you and send thank you notes back to the place you interned for and always stay in touch with that person.
